NayaPay has just unlocked a major upgrade for Pakistani travelers. The fintech, through the latest partnership with Alipay+, has introduced Global QR Payments for millions of its users, enabling them to scan and pay in more than 50 countries from cafes and shops to transportation services and entertainment spots.
This integration means that NayaPay customers can have a safe, and affordable payment experience nearly anywhere in the world. Alipay+ already connects more than 40 international mobile payment partners with 150 million-plus merchants, so the acceptance network is huge-especially for students, workers, and frequent travelers.
This launch builds upon NayaPay’s existing features such as Visa debit cards, local and international transfers, bill payments, and remittances. It also follows their big milestone in 2024 when they became the first Pakistani fintech to enable direct QR payments at 80 million merchants in China.
As per NayaPay CEO Danish A. Lakhani, the goal is to give Pakistanis the same confidence and convenience as those in advanced markets. Ant International’s Yan Pan said platforms like NayaPay are changing how people travel and make payments across the world.
